Output e4bd43ea5365e6dfb53fece5d165b8186f2ae4ba7dc8fb80b0467fd481f571ea:1

value
10989813
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ec6dc0b0d877dd74cd5068af0eee6305591f58fd OP_EQUAL
address
3PF8sZqLWF386oJ4nt25Aqvqe9wwqk9Kze
transaction
e4bd43ea5365e6dfb53fece5d165b8186f2ae4ba7dc8fb80b0467fd481f571ea
spent
true